JAVA是一種能夠 編寫混合開發(fā)系統(tǒng)軟件的面向對象編程的編程設計語言,是由SunMicrosystems企業(yè)于1996年五月發(fā)布的Java編程設計語言和JAVA服務平臺(即JavaSE,JavaEE,JavaME)的統(tǒng)稱。根據(jù)java培訓學習,走入IT的全球,領略到高薪職位產(chǎn)生的快樂!
Java未來發(fā)展趨勢
Java9的發(fā)布
Java 9將是自被Oracle收購后發(fā)布的首個重大版本。Java 9的主要目標是大限度實現(xiàn)模塊化以幫助人們實現(xiàn)積木式的應用編寫。目的是幫助人們從JAR的束縛中解脫出來。該特性將貫穿整個Java庫,并以單依賴圖的方式重新整理依賴。
Java對物聯(lián)網(wǎng)的支持
為了進入物聯(lián)網(wǎng)領域,Java升級了CLDC和Netbean,直接從J2ME升級到JavaME8。而在近期更是推出了一款非常精巧且可以運行Java語言的物聯(lián)網(wǎng)模塊:Cinterion EHS5,這款模塊是專門為物聯(lián)網(wǎng)而定制。
與時俱進,Spring框架能與其他很多框架和第三方庫共存,并且還可以將其集成進來。當使用了Spring 4后,其相應的依賴也會一并得到更新,這樣就可以使用新的庫了。不再有JAR地獄的煩惱。
Java微框架逐步流行
隨著語言的成熟,每次發(fā)布都會增加一些庫。時間一久,對于大部分項目而言,包含在這些庫中的許多功能都不是它們真正需要的。微框架就是要解決這個問題,其思想是:創(chuàng)建一個靈活的解決方案。
促進大數(shù)據(jù)的發(fā)展
沒有Java,甚至不會有大數(shù)據(jù)的大發(fā)展,Hadoop本身就是用Java編寫的。當你需要在運行MapReduce的服務器集群上發(fā)布新功能時,你需要進行動態(tài)的部署,而這正是Java所擅長的。
Java嵌入黃金時代
從Java切入嵌入式系統(tǒng)的領地算起的大約5~7年之后,針對硬實時和深度嵌入式系統(tǒng)的Java產(chǎn)品已經(jīng)呈現(xiàn)一片生機盎然的景象。針對嵌入式系統(tǒng)的Java有可能迎來黃金時代,正以高復合年增長率發(fā)展。